Not SNM, but....
Kayfuns... all models but the V4 which, while a fine vape, is over-engineered (ime) and may be a bit too fiddly for some.
Simple design, little to go wrong.
Airflow great for tootle puffers, right out of the box. (Yes, there are models and "kits" to increase that if desired.)
Can take darn near any build you want to throw on them, and a simple single strand open or compressed coil gives a great vape. Very "forgiving" of errors with that and/or wicking, it will still vape fine.
Ime, no leaks. Just be sure all o-rings are good. Even after re-filling. (I tend to top fill my 3.1s, simple inversion while attaching the cap, no leaks. The rest I do use the fill screw. No leaks.) Won't leak even upside down (although, of course, any prior condensation will come out!)
Sturdy, even with the PMMA center tube. The full M5 tank, not quite a sturdy, but unless you've gone with some of the aftermarket PMMA chimneys, which aren't as sturdy as stainless, of course, will laugh off most drops. (Yes, I have!)
